1、前提不说了,MySql不可使用。

2、首先卸载MySql,然后删除安装目录。可以在D盘或者C盘中搜索MySql,然后将相关的文件夹删除。

3、删除注册表中的相关选项。这里也可以使用搜索。搜索时只选择项,将值和的勾去掉。然后将搜到的MySql项删除。接下来就可以安装MySql了

4、安装过程很简单,照着步骤就可以了。接下来会要你安装MySql的服务,如果之前还有删除MySql留下来的服务,可以在cmd命令下使用sc delete mysql //这里的mysql是你要删除的服务名。注意这里cmd要在管理员模式下面运行,否则没有权限。

服务安装完成后,可以使用navicat等工具连接数据库测试下。接着按照下面的步骤进行数据库的恢复,前提是之前的MySql目录下的data文件夹还在。

1.停止mysql服务(管理工具——服务,或者DOS命令net stop mysql停止,启动net start mysql);

2.将旧的ibdata1 (这里只需要这一个文件就可以了)覆盖本来的,再把相关的数据库copy过去(简之:最好备份本来的data为olddata将以前的data覆盖现有的data);

3.启动mysql服务,然后再启动数据库.

就可以了,进入后如果对表不能操作可能是数据表已经损坏了.(或有的版本不支持直接拷贝)

mysql重装恢复之前数据_MySql5.0重装以及恢复之前的数据库相关推荐

  1. 恢复内存卡数据需要什么软件才能恢复呢

    恢复内存卡数据需要什么软件才能恢复呢 紧急求助:怎么恢复被删除的手机通讯录?手机通讯录可以说是我们手机中最重要的应用功能之一,特别是我们在更换手机的时候,首先要做的就是把旧手机上面的联系人更新到新手机 ...

  2. mysql 8.0数据备份恢复_RDS for MySQL8.0物理备份恢复到本地自建数据库

    此文章是centos7下的恢复流程. yum localinstall mysql80-community-release-el7-1.noarch.rpm yum -y install yum-ut ...

  3. linux系统重装后挂载数据盘,Linux重装系统后如何重新挂载数据盘?

    在 注意事项 数据盘分区名称为 /dev/vdb1,挂载点名称为 /mnt,新的挂载点名称必须与系统盘初始化之前 /dev/vdb1 的挂载点名称保持一致.您可以通过 cat /etc/fstab命令 ...

  4. mysql统计分析,无数据补0

    如题 这个分两种情况: 不需要补0 -- 查询最近七天工单 select date_format(createTime,"%Y-%m-%d") as days,count(*) a ...

  5. mysql根据id删除数据sql语句_sql delete根据id删除数据库

    {"moduleinfo":{"card_count":[{"count_phone":1,"count":1}],&q ...

  6. mysql 5.6 json查询_mysql5.6及以下版本如何查询数据库里的json

    MySQL里面保存数据有时候会把一些杂乱且不常用的时候丢进一个json字段里面 下面说说mysql存储json注意那些格式吧: 1:注意保存是中文不要变成转码的,转码之后导致查询非常麻烦,压缩时候后面 ...

  7. mysql 闪回_MySQL数据误删除的快速解决方法(MySQL闪回工具)

    概述 Binlog2sql是一个Python开发开源的MySQL Binlog解析工具,能够将Binlog解析为原始的SQL,也支持将Binlog解析为回滚的SQL,去除主键的INSERT SQL,是 ...

  8. 计算机清理垃圾文件丢失怎么恢复,清理电脑后怎样恢复丢失数据_电脑数据恢复_迷你兔...

    清理电脑后怎样恢复丢失数据_电脑数据恢复_迷你兔 分类:数据恢复常见问题|最后更新:2019年5月10日 许多人会有规划地对自己的电脑进行清理工作,这么做的原因有可能是电脑垃圾文件太多,也可能是电脑剩 ...

  9. 如何恢复微信聊天记录?适合小白的恢复方法

    想知道如何恢复微信聊天记录吗?微信聊天记录恢复的确可以通过几种不同的途径进行,不过根据每个人的工作性质或者是恢复紧急程度,我们仍是建议选择最合适自己的方法.目前来说,如果有备份的用户,基本上是通过iT ...

最新文章

  1. python访问多个网站_Python多并发访问网站
  2. LinkedBlockingQueue 注记
  3. 论IP地址在数据库中应该用何种形式存储
  4. hive插入数据:FAILED: ParseException line 1:12 missing TABLE at 'student' near 'EOF'
  5. 望SQLServer 高手指点
  6. 前端学习(1409):多人管理29安装json转换工具
  7. [密码学基础][每个信息安全博士生应该知道的52件事][Bristol52]47.什么是Fiat-Shamir变换?
  8. python的序列类型及其特点_Fluent Python 笔记——序列类型及其丰富的操作
  9. python将空格变成换行_Python基础之PEP8规范(代码写作规范)
  10. 【python】集合的定义与操作
  11. 前端发送的字符串有大小限制吗_前端经典面试题 30道
  12. 两万字长文读懂 Java 集合!
  13. php curl exec ch,PHP curl_exec函数
  14. html5 苹果没有音乐播放器,GitHub - ksky521/player: html5版本音乐播放器,支持iOS设备...
  15. window强制删除文件bat
  16. 极值点、驻点、拐点的区别-----专升本
  17. cad面积计算机,用cad计算多个面积的方法步骤
  18. Java空指针异常和解决办法
  19. 请输入星期几的第一个字母来判断一下是星期几
  20. Latex编辑数学符号和希腊字母的方法

热门文章

  1. mongoTemplate聚合aggregate操作
  2. node节点的资源限制
  3. Unix时间戳(Unix timestamp)及其他时间标准
  4. BMS软件策略测试,电池管理系统BMS的常见测试方法
  5. 全连接神经网络 MLP
  6. 纯css满屏图像幻灯片制作
  7. 顶级程序员的成长之路1
  8. VUE(template标签 事件绑定与监听)
  9. 铨顺宏RFID:医院工作人员/养老院UWB工作人员定位解决方法
  10. 哪些蓝牙耳机防水性强?防水蓝牙耳机推荐